Remembering with love and appreciation for a father, dad, grandaddy, and business partner - Dick Flood, 90, also known as Okefenokee Joe, author and proclaimed storyteller/singer/songwriter, who passed away on Monday, January 9, 2023 at the Charlie Norwood VA Medical Center in Augusta, GA.

My Walk Among The Stars- Rubbing Shoulders with Country Giants

by Dick Flood

Told in 210 pages this book is the story of one man’s 19 year journey of exhilarating successes, frustrating almosts and heartbreaking failures while writing, singing and performing with his own original music, and knowing personally and working with dozens of America’s greatest country music celebrities of the 1960s. In thirty-seven fascinating chapters the author carries us on his exciting tours and adventures to cites and towns all over the United States, Europe, Southeast Asia, Puerto Rico, Africa, The Caribbean Islands, Newfoundland and Labrador. This book is also an excellent and professional inside look at the pros and cons and the dos and donts of a would be country music singer/song writer/entertainer.
